Moisture matters more than most people expect. Timber is conditioned before machining, and anything going into a kitchen, utility or bathroom is specified in materials that will not swell at the bottom edge. That is why the base of a well-made unit still closes cleanly after five winters.

Every finished job gets a short handover: what the surface is, how to clean it, and how to adjust a hinge if a door drops after the heating has been on for a season. Adjustment is normal in timber and takes about two minutes once you know which screw to turn.

Do you handle the glazing and signwriting?
We build and fit the joinery and coordinate the glazier. Signwriting is a separate trade, but we size the fascia and set the blocking to carry it, which is the part that goes wrong when a fascia is built too shallow.
Do I need consent to replace a timber shopfront?
If the building is listed or in a conservation area, yes — listed building consent or planning permission is usually required, and the officer will want to see a drawn elevation with mouldings and section sizes. We produce those drawings as part of the survey so you are not submitting a photograph and hoping.
How long does a shopfront take?
Eight to twelve weeks from signed drawings, most of which is machining and finishing rather than fitting. The fit itself is typically two to four days. Trading can usually continue, though the glazing day needs the frontage clear.
Is a timber shopfront secure enough?
Security comes from the glazing spec and the closing hardware, not the timber. We build for laminated glass, concealed shootbolts and a proper mortice, and we can detail for a shutter box behind the fascia so the shutter does not spoil the elevation.
